Output 629f50ee99363ac0782d393065228a86abef048d4d1dbf4a8f6d2caca124c0f9:0

value
999556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a7e606844688d37d57c1ec8abcbd4123122a97 OP_EQUAL
address
3CR87nMWLZrLkyxJ9RA2TQYKLAVQLPnyQk
transaction
629f50ee99363ac0782d393065228a86abef048d4d1dbf4a8f6d2caca124c0f9